I get the following warning when I compile src/bin/pg_id/pg_id.c:
gcc -pipe -g -Wall -Wmissing-prototypes -Wmissing-declarations -I../../../src/include -c -o pg_id.o pg_id.c -MMD pg_id.c: In function `main': pg_id.c:35: warning: unused variable `optarg' The attached trivial patch fixes the warning by removing the variable. Neil Conway
